Deem is a creative partnership between two design studios: NY-based Openbox and LA-based Room for Magic.
Deem Journal stands as a prominent voice in Book and Periodical Publishing, dedicated to exploring design as a social practice. Defining design as the process of adding value, Deem Journal believes in its fundamental and ubiquitous nature. The journal explores human-centric design models, transcending exclusive institutions and industry categories, fostering trans-disciplinary and intergenerational conversations to uncover meaningful narratives. Located in Los Angeles, Deem Journal is committed to understanding our histories and imagining our futures through insightful design perspectives.
